Mixed-language debugging would be brilliant, but unfortunately Eclipse doesn't support it right now. They are talking about it for future releases. It would surely require a total redesign of the existing Jess debugger, but it would be worth it.
Maybe you can factor the Java setup code so that you can call it from Jess with a single call, then just debug the Jess code.
